2. Cybrary

The “Penetration Testing and Ethical Hacking” course offered by Cybrary is a free online training program designed to master ethical hacking techniques. This course is aimed at individuals interested in cybersecurity, particularly in offensive security roles.

It covers a variety of attack types, including password cracking, DDoS, SQL injection, session hijacking, social engineering, and other hacking techniques. The course also provides an introduction to ethical hacking concepts, as well as web server and web application hacking.

Optional labs are available that help students gain the hands-on hacking skills necessary to be successful in the field. The course is taught by Bill Price, who has over 16 years of experience working with businesses on network security.

3. Hack The Box

Hack The Box’s “Hacker” program is a comprehensive platform designed for individuals at various levels of cybersecurity expertise, from beginners to seasoned professionals.

The program offers over 450 hacking labs and boasts a community of 2.6 million members. These resources cover a wide range of cybersecurity topics, including binary exploitation, the OWASP Top 10, and blue teaming. The program also features Pro Labs, which simulate real-world penetration testing scenarios on enterprise infrastructure.

Hack The Box offers a gamified hacking experience with HTB Seasons and Hacking Battlegrounds, allowing users to compete and level up their skills.

5. Udemy

Learn Ethical Hacking From Scratch” on Udemy is a comprehensive course designed for individuals with no prior knowledge in ethical hacking or cybersecurity. Created by Zaid Sabih and z Security, this course includes over 145 videos, totaling more than 15 hours, and covers a wide range of ethical hacking topics.

The course utilizes over 30 hacking tools such as Metasploit, Aircrack-ng, SQLmap, etc., and provides 85+ hands-on real-life hacking examples. It covers various aspects of ethical hacking, including hacking and securing WiFi and wired networks, hacking cloud servers, creating backdoors, exploiting web application vulnerabilities, and more.

The course aims to take learners from a beginner level to a high-intermediate level in ethical hacking and also teaches how to secure systems from the demonstrated attacks.

7. OffSec

The “Metasploit Unleashed (MSFU)” course, offered by Offensive Security, is a comprehensive and free online ethical hacking course. This course is provided to raise awareness for underprivileged children in East Africa, and participants are encouraged to donate to the Hackers For Charity non-profit organization.

It serves as an ideal starting point for Information Security Professionals who want to learn penetration testing and ethical hacking but are not yet ready to commit to a paid course.

The course teaches how to use Metasploit in a structured and intuitive manner and serves as a quick reference for penetration testers, red teams, and other security professionals.

9. InfoSec Institute

The “Ethical Hacking Dual Certification Boot Camp (CEH and PenTest+)” offered by the Infosec Institute is an intensive five-day training program designed to immerse students in real-world scenarios for practical application of ethical hacking concepts.

This boot camp is tailored for individuals aiming to earn both the CompTIA PenTest+ and EC-Council Certified Ethical Hacker (CEH) certifications. The course provides in-depth training in ethical hacking methodologies through lectures and hands-on labs in a cloud-hosted cyber range.

It covers reconnaissance, system access, vulnerability exploitation, and data exfiltration. The course is suitable for penetration and vulnerability testers, cybersecurity analysts, consultants, and offensive security professionals. It also meets the DoD Information Assurance requirements.
